Avery point, CT

Avery Point was constructed as a memorial to the legacy of keepers. The octagonal red block tower is topped by an 8-sided wood lantern room. The beacon originally projected a steady white light of 100 candlepower but was no longer attended or maintained after 1967. In 1997, a movement was spearheaded to save the decaying structure. A dedicated Corps of volunteers has restored this sentinel to pristine condition once again and successfully had it listed as a National Historic Site.
